Output 7d6f7059e85914ac4e99f29ec3d17ebfdc67d1e9df9043951b9c53c8a7403292:12

value
3365158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4795cc441098a32de9d409feab6627347facfa9b OP_EQUAL
address
38DXMJf15VPLdu3Fd4H7yQVx8wdFPUY55Y
transaction
7d6f7059e85914ac4e99f29ec3d17ebfdc67d1e9df9043951b9c53c8a7403292
spent
true